Dr. Nour Makarem joins ZOE Science & Nutrition to discuss the critical role of sleep in heart health. Sleep is described as the foundation upon which diet, exercise, and overall wellbeing are built. Research suggests that poor sleep quality can significantly increase the risk of heart disease and heart attacks. Notably, both too little and too much sleep raise concerns, indicating an optimal range. This episode highlights the connection between sleep and cardiovascular health and why it matters.
